I love my old "Blue Streak" Sheridan. Mine is a pump air rifle chambered to fit 5mm or 20 caliber. The pellets I prefer are the Beeman hollow points. It is very accurate. I use mine to control the rabbit population occasionally and to plink cans. Over the years, the seals dry out and I have had them replaced by a company that services air rifles. The stocks on the old models are walnut. About seven pumps maximum but four or five is sufficient for power and accuracy if the seals are still good. At seven pumps it should go through the front ofa tin can and dent the heck out of the back. Be careful, they are not toys.
